Falmer station takes care of its travelers with a variety of facilities. There's a staffed ticket office open from 06:25 to 19:50 during weekdays and Saturdays, although it closes earlier on Sundays at 16:45. If you're in a hurry, ticket machines are readily available and accessible to all passengers, including those eligible for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
For those requiring assistance, staff are available throughout the week with comprehensive support services, including a help point on the platforms. It's advised to book assistance two hours in advance but "turn up and go" assistance is facilitated when possible. Train carriages themselves often have staff able to lend a hand, ensuring a hassle-free journey.
Safety at the station is prioritized with CCTV in place, and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. While there are toilets on Platform 2, the station lacks accessible toilets and baby changing facilities. Comfortable unheated waiting shelters provide respite between journeys, and there's seating for passengers choosing to rest their feet.

The station is equipped with ticket-buying facilities to cater to a variety of passenger needs. With ticket machines available, securing your travel tickets is a hassle-free task. Additionally, these machines are accessible, supporting those who use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. While smartcard services are offered, it’s worth noting that the station doesn’t support Wi-Fi or provide a visible ATM, so plan accordingly.
For those looking for a helping hand, staff assistance at Enfield Chase is available from 5:00 AM to 1:00 AM, offering support during most travel times. The accessibility offerings, however, are a bit limited, as the station lacks step-free access and essential amenities such as accessible toilets. Nonetheless, there is a heated waiting room on Platform 1, offering some comfort during cooler days.
In terms of onward connections, Enfield Chase is well-linked with alternative transport options. While rail replacement services are available during disruptions, detailed onward travel plans can be explored through maps provided at the station. Although there's no direct provision for car rental services at the station, local bus stops and taxi services are easily accessible, presenting a variety of ways to continue your journey. Drivers will be glad to know there's a modest car parking lot managed by APCOA, offering free parking.
